2014-02-07 67 views
0

我正在学习jQuery的mobile..I需要从JSON value..How我能做到这一点动态创建的GridView ..jQuery Mobile的GridView中动态创建

到现在我试过..

这是我的GridView

<div class="ui-grid-a" id="category_grid"> 
      <div id="category_gridrow" class="ui-block-b"><p>This is block A</p></div>    
</div> 

我的脚本数据....

<script > 

var data = { "Products":[ 
     { 
      "itemname":"Camera", 
      "submenu": [{ 
       "itemname":"cannon", 
      },{ 
       "itemname":"Kodak", 
      },{ 
       "itemname":"Sony", 
      }] 
     }, 

     { 
      "itemname":"Lighting", 
     }, 

     { 
      "itemname":"Backdrop", 
      "submenu": [{ 
       "itemname":"Blue", 
      },{ 
       "itemname":"Black", 
      }] 
     } 
]} 

var cat=''; 


for (var i in data.Products) 
    {   
      cat ="<p>"+ data.Products[i].itemname + "</p>";   
      $("#category_gridrow").html(cat);   
} 
</script> 

但我不知道如何提高电网dynamically..help我..

回答

0

那么朋友,我发现它。我们可以添加像下面..

$('#category_grid').append('<div id="category_gridrow" class="ui-block-b">'+cat+'</div></div>'); 
相关问题